Job description

Join us as Head of Payments and Open Banking

  • As Head of Payments and Open Banking, you’ll set the strategic direction of the team, supported by the senior technical members
  • You’ll take responsibility for the end-to-end delivery of strategic and tactical projects, delivering agreed business outcomes and coordinating various technology and change teams to achieve this
  • Joining a fast paced and forward thinking environment, you’ll benefit from valuable stakeholder exposure, and will gain great recognition for you and your work
What you'll do

In your new role, you’ll be accountable for making sure that project deliverables can achieve sustainable business and customer goals, while ensuring all governance, risk, finances and resources are managed effectively across a range of delivery methodologies. You’ll prepare a financial business case for the technology programme with a clear line of sight to customer value being delivered in accordance with the technology investment portfolio and funding requirements, making sure that the reputation of the bank is built, safeguarded, and kept foremost in the mind, while interacting with all stakeholders.

You’ll also:

  • Ensure that work done is aligned to the principles of software development across the bank
  • Deliver architectural and functional improvements that will have a positive impact on our technology estate and business
  • Drive and contribute to the technology strategy roadmap
  • Understand and incorporate requirements originating from the programmes in which the project team is involved
  • Influence delivery plans and coordinating delivery across multiple projects and deliverables
The skills you'll need

Experience in leading and managing development teams will be required, as will knowledge of the key phases of software delivery lifecycles and established software development methodologies. We’ll also look for experience in driving change through to a successful conclusion and the ability to influence at all levels.

In addition, you’ll need experience with Payments and Open Banking and have extensive knowledge of project finances and reporting.

Having knowledge of Wealth, products, clients and architecture would be beneficial

You’ll also need:

  • Good knowledge of technical architecture and the functionality of applications used to support the business
  • Experience of working in a dynamic environment often with shifting priorities
  • The ability to quickly understand and be familiar with complex systems
  • Experience of delivering projects in geographically dispersed teams
  • Excellent stakeholder management skills
  • Strong communicator and ability to communicate project concepts to stakeholders, senior IT counterparts and group colleagues
